Bug 436663 - systemsettings5 crashed while configuring Blur in Desktop Effects on Wayland
Summary: systemsettings5 crashed while configuring Blur in Desktop Effects on Wayland
Status: RESOLVED DUPLICATE of bug 414834
Alias: None
Product: systemsettings
Classification: Applications
Component: kcm_kwindecoration (show other bugs)
Version: unspecified
Platform: Fedora RPMs Linux
: NOR crash
Target Milestone: ---
Assignee: Plasma Bugs List
URL:
Keywords: drkonqi
Depends on:
Blocks:
 
Reported: 2021-05-06 00:10 UTC by Nathan Lutterman
Modified: 2021-05-06 01:01 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Nathan Lutterman 2021-05-06 00:10:25 UTC
Application: systemsettings5 (5.21.5)

Qt Version: 5.15.2
Frameworks Version: 5.82.0
Operating System: Linux 5.13.0-0.rc0.20210428gitacd3d2859453.2.fc35.x86_64 x86_64
Windowing System: Wayland
Drkonqi Version: 5.21.5
Distribution: Fedora 35 (KDE Plasma Prerelease)

-- Information about the crash:
- What I was doing when the application crashed:

I had finished changing the color scheme to Breeze Dark and changed my icons and cursors to Papirus and Volantes, respectively. I also built and installed the Lightly window decoration style and installed it, but can't recall if I had selected that before or after this exception occurred.  

I began adjusting the Workspace Behavior, specifically Desktop effects, selecting and deselecting different options to see what the changes looked like.  I did not alter default transparency settings, so they were and are transparent upon moving.  When I enabled the "Blur" option under "Appearance" and the settings application crashed.  

I may also have adjusted compositor settings, changing it from OpenGL 3.1 to XRender and back again. In an attempt to reproduce the bug, I made that change and managed to have the same exact exception and stack trace occur a second time, but have not been able to trigger it again.

- Custom settings of the application:

Currently:
Appearance -> Blur: Enabled, default settings
Appearance -> Translucency: Enabled, default settings
Compositor -> OpenGL 3.1
Window Decoration -> Lightly, compiled from source (commit be20234dfb56e936735d215e15e96c6ec0f36e7a: https://github.com/Luwx/Lightly/tree/be20234dfb56e936735d215e15e96c6ec0f36e7a)

Please let me know if I can be of any further assistance!

Thanks!

The reporter is unsure if this crash is reproducible.

-- Backtrace:
Application: System Settings (systemsettings5), signal: Segmentation fault

[KCrash Handler]
#4  0x00007f8a52208b38 in typeinfo for GenericBinding<1> () from /lib64/libQt5Qml.so.5
#5  0x00007f8a50af3ec7 in QWaylandClientExtensionPrivate::handleRegistryGlobal (data=0x557d2fd43560, registry=0x557d2e2806a0, id=50, interface=..., version=1) at global/qwaylandclientextension.cpp:67
#6  0x00007f8a50ae03d9 in QtWaylandClient::QWaylandDisplay::registry_global (this=<optimized out>, id=<optimized out>, interface=..., version=<optimized out>) at /usr/src/debug/qt5-qtwayland-5.15.2-6.fc35.x86_64/src/client/qwaylanddisplay.cpp:397
#7  0x00007f8a50afc753 in QtWayland::wl_registry::handle_global (data=0x557d2e2810e0, object=<optimized out>, name=50, interface=0x557d3111df10 "org_kde_kwin_blur_manager", version=1) at /usr/src/debug/qt5-qtwayland-5.15.2-6.fc35.x86_64/src/client/qwayland-wayland.cpp:94
#8  0x00007f8a4e4bec04 in ffi_call_unix64 () at ../src/x86/unix64.S:76
#9  0x00007f8a4e4be107 in ffi_call (cif=cif@entry=0x7ffceb243ed0, fn=<optimized out>, rvalue=<optimized out>, rvalue@entry=0x0, avalue=avalue@entry=0x7ffceb243fa0) at ../src/x86/ffi64.c:525
#10 0x00007f8a50a4dd10 in wl_closure_invoke (closure=closure@entry=0x557d3111de30, target=<optimized out>, target@entry=0x557d2e2806a0, opcode=opcode@entry=0, data=<optimized out>, flags=<optimized out>) at ../src/connection.c:1018
#11 0x00007f8a50a4e42b in dispatch_event (display=0x557d2e284d80, queue=<optimized out>, queue=<optimized out>) at ../src/wayland-client.c:1452
#12 0x00007f8a50a4e61c in dispatch_queue (queue=0x557d2e284e50, display=0x557d2e284d80) at ../src/wayland-client.c:1598
#13 wl_display_dispatch_queue_pending (display=0x557d2e284d80, queue=0x557d2e284e50) at ../src/wayland-client.c:1840
#14 0x00007f8a50ad85df in QtWaylandClient::QWaylandDisplay::flushRequests (this=0x557d2e2810d0) at /usr/src/debug/qt5-qtwayland-5.15.2-6.fc35.x86_64/src/client/qwaylanddisplay.cpp:222
#15 0x00007f8a52e684fd in doActivate<false> (sender=0x557d2e29cbc0, signal_index=4, argv=0x7ffceb244200) at kernel/qobject.cpp:3898
#16 0x00007f8a52e629e7 in QMetaObject::activate (sender=sender@entry=0x557d2e29cbc0, m=m@entry=0x7f8a530fcac0 <QAbstractEventDispatcher::staticMetaObject>, local_signal_index=local_signal_index@entry=1, argv=argv@entry=0x0) at kernel/qobject.cpp:3946
#17 0x00007f8a52e34a87 in QAbstractEventDispatcher::awake (this=this@entry=0x557d2e29cbc0) at .moc/moc_qabstracteventdispatcher.cpp:149
#18 0x00007f8a52e8478b in QEventDispatcherGlib::processEvents (this=0x557d2e29cbc0, flags=...) at kernel/qeventdispatcher_glib.cpp:430
#19 0x00007f8a52e369b2 in QEventLoop::exec (this=this@entry=0x7ffceb244320, flags=..., flags@entry=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:69
#20 0x00007f8a52e3e544 in QCoreApplication::exec () at ../../include/QtCore/../../src/corelib/global/qflags.h:121
#21 0x0000557d2e1d2d4c in main ()
[Inferior 1 (process 3724) detached]

Possible duplicates by query: bug 435992, bug 435427, bug 434974, bug 434725, bug 434236.

Reported using DrKonqi
Comment 1 Nathan Lutterman 2021-05-06 00:56:21 UTC
Possible duplicate of bug 414834?
Comment 2 Nathan Lutterman 2021-05-06 01:01:31 UTC

*** This bug has been marked as a duplicate of bug 414834 ***